At mega rally, minorities vow to ensure victory for Amson Mallick

Odisha Politics

Mohana: Odisha Mulnivasi Mancha convenor Rabi Rathan on Saturday attacked BJP and Congress for making false promises and misleading voters ahead of the general election and Assembly elections.

While addressing an election rally organized for independent candidate Amson Mallick for Mohana Assembly constituency, Rathan also criticised the former MLA for ignoring dalits, tribals and minorities.

Many State-level Christian leaders, social activists attended the rally and decided to ensure victory for Amson Mallick. Nearly, 5,000 people attended the rally.

All Odisha Christian Council general secretary Thomas Michel said that, “The Church does not have any ideological leanings or association with any political party, front or candidate. But we are concerned about minorities’ rights and safety.”

He said that Mohana Assembly constituency has 73 per cent Christian population. “And we do not like to see another Kandhamal-like situationin Gajapati.”

Among others, youth leader Manoj Paltasingh, Prakash Nayak, Simancha Parichha, Rutu Mallick, Lazar Majhi and advocate Rabindra Singh vowed to support Amson.
